Lal Kitab, also known as the "Red Book," is a unique system of astrology and palmistry that originated in India. It is a set of books written in Urdu language, which is said to have been authored by Pt. Roop Chand Joshi in the 19th century. Lal Kitab is considered to be a revolutionary work in the field of astrology as it deviates from traditional Hindu astrology principles and presents a distinct and unconventional approach towards interpreting horoscopes and providing remedies.

The philosophy behind Lal Kitab is based on the belief that the karmic effects of past lives are responsible for the problems and challenges faced by an individual in the present life. It emphasizes the concept of "karma" and suggests that through certain remedies, one can mitigate the negative effects of past karma and improve their present life. Lal Kitab takes into consideration the planetary positions at the time of an individual's birth and provides practical and effective remedies to counteract the negative influences of the planets.

 

The Concept of Lal Kitab

Lal Kitab is founded on the concept of astrology and palmistry, which are ancient Vedic sciences that have been practiced in India for centuries. However, Lal Kitab has its unique approach and concepts that differentiate it from traditional astrology. Some of the key concepts of Lal Kitab are:

The concept of karmic debts: Lal Kitab believes that an individual's current life is influenced by their past karma, both positive and negative. It suggests that certain planetary positions in a person's birth chart are responsible for the debts or karmic imbalances carried forward from past lives. These karmic debts manifest as problems or challenges in the present life.

The concept of malefic planets: Lal Kitab considers some planets as "malefic" or negative, such as Saturn, Rahu, and Ketu, which are believed to cause obstacles and difficulties in an individual's life. It suggests that these planets can create imbalances and unfavorable situations if not properly addressed.

The concept of "upayas" or remedies: Lal Kitab emphasizes the use of practical and simple remedies, known as "upayas," to mitigate the negative effects of planetary positions and karmic debts. These remedies are based on specific rituals, prayers, and acts of charity, which are believed to help an individual overcome their karmic debts and improve their present life.

The concept of personalized horoscopes: Lal Kitab believes that every individual has a unique birth chart, which reflects their past karma and present destiny. It emphasizes the importance of analyzing the planetary positions and combinations in an individual's horoscope to provide personalized remedies that are specific to their karmic debts and challenges.

Philosophy of Lal Kitab

The philosophy of Lal Kitab is based on the concept of karma, which is the belief that an individual's actions in the past life determine their current life's circumstances. It suggests that every action has consequences, and the positive or negative effects of past actions are carried forward into the present life. According to Lal Kitab, the karmic debts or imbalances from past lives can manifest as problems or challenges in an individual's present life, and these can be mitigated through appropriate remedies.

Lal Kitab believes that planets in an individual's birth chart have a direct influence on their life and destiny. It suggests that the favorable or unfavorable positions of planets at the time of birth can impact an individual's health, career, relationships, and overall well-being. Lal Kitab considers some planets as malefic or negative, and their unfavorable positions in an individual's horoscope are believed to cause problems and challenges.

However, Lal Kitab also emphasizes that these negative influences can be mitigated through practical and simple remedies. These remedies, known as "upayas," are based on specific rituals, prayers, and acts of charity that are believed to counteract the negative effects of planets and karmic debts.

The philosophy of Lal Kitab also emphasizes the importance of personalized horoscopes. According to Lal Kitab, every individual has a unique birth chart that reflects their past karma and present destiny. It suggests that the planetary positions and combinations in an individual's horoscope should be carefully analyzed to provide customized remedies that are specific to their karmic imbalances and challenges. This personalized approach makes Lal Kitab distinct from traditional astrology, which often provides general remedies without taking into consideration the individual's unique birth chart.

One of the fundamental principles of the philosophy of Lal Kitab is the belief in the power of remedies. Lal Kitab suggests that through appropriate remedies, an individual can neutralize the negative influences of past karma and planets, and improve their present life. These remedies are designed to be practical, simple, and easy to follow, making them accessible to people from all walks of life.

The remedies prescribed in Lal Kitab include a wide range of practices such as offering prayers, performing rituals, wearing specific gemstones or amulets, observing fasts, and making charitable donations. These remedies are believed to appease the malefic planets, propitiate the deities, and balance the karmic debts. For example, if an individual has a malefic Saturn in their birth chart, Lal Kitab may suggest remedies such as donating black sesame seeds, offering prayers to Lord Shani (the deity associated with Saturn), or wearing a blue sapphire gemstone to counteract the negative effects of Saturn.

Another unique aspect of the philosophy of Lal Kitab is the concept of "Talismans" or "Amulets." Lal Kitab suggests that wearing specific talismans or amulets can enhance the positive energies and protect against negative energies. These talismans are believed to have a protective and empowering effect on an individual's life and are often personalized based on their birth chart and karmic debts.

Lal Kitab also emphasizes the importance of practicality and simplicity in its remedies. Unlike traditional astrology, which may prescribe complex rituals or elaborate ceremonies, Lal Kitab focuses on remedies that are easy to perform and integrate into one's daily life. This practical approach makes Lal Kitab accessible to a wider audience and has contributed to its popularity among people seeking simple yet effective solutions to their life's problems.

The concept of "Debts" or "Rin" is also central to the philosophy of Lal Kitab. Lal Kitab suggests that an individual carries forward karmic debts from past lives, which manifest as problems or challenges in the present life. These debts can be related to relationships, health, wealth, or other areas of life. Lal Kitab believes that by addressing these karmic debts through appropriate remedies, an individual can improve their present life and future prospects.

The remedies in Lal Kitab are also aimed at enhancing positive energies and bringing about favorable changes in an individual's life. For example, Lal Kitab may prescribe remedies to strengthen the positive influences of planets that are favorable in an individual's birth chart. These remedies may include offering prayers to the respective deities, wearing specific gemstones or amulets, or performing rituals to propitiate the planets. By strengthening the positive energies, Lal Kitab aims to create a harmonious balance in an individual's life and enhance their overall well-being.

The concept of "Ratna" or gemstones is also an important aspect of the philosophy of Lal Kitab. Lal Kitab suggests that wearing specific gemstones can have a positive influence on an individual's life by enhancing the energies of favorable planets and mitigating the negative effects of malefic planets. However, unlike traditional astrology which prescribes gemstones based on the placement of planets in the birth chart, Lal Kitab assigns gemstones based on the individual's birth year. This unique approach is known as the "Ratna Shastra" or the science of gemstones in Lal Kitab.

According to Lal Kitab, each year is associated with a specific gemstone that is believed to have a positive impact on an individual's life during that particular year. For example, Lal Kitab suggests that wearing a Ruby gemstone can be beneficial for individuals born in the years of Sun, while wearing a Pearl gemstone can be beneficial for individuals born in the years of Moon, and so on. These gemstones are believed to have the power to enhance the favorable energies of the corresponding planet and bring about positive changes in an individual's life.

Another important concept in the philosophy of Lal Kitab is the role of "Karmic Remedies." Lal Kitab suggests that an individual's present life is influenced by their past karma, and the challenges or problems they face are often a result of their past actions. Lal Kitab believes that by addressing and rectifying their past karma through appropriate remedies, an individual can improve their present life and future prospects.

The karmic remedies in Lal Kitab are designed to help individuals identify and rectify their past mistakes or wrongdoings. These remedies may include acts of charity, performing rituals, seeking forgiveness, or making amends. By addressing their past karma and seeking redemption, an individual can neutralize the negative effects of their past actions and create positive karma for their future.

The philosophy of Lal Kitab also places a strong emphasis on the importance of faith and belief in the efficacy of remedies. It suggests that the success of remedies depends not only on the ritualistic aspects but also on the individual's faith and belief in the process. Lal Kitab emphasizes that individuals should perform remedies with a pure heart, sincere intention, and unwavering faith in the power of the remedies to bring about positive changes in their life.

Final Takeaway

Lal Kitab is a unique and distinct system of astrology that originated in India and is known for its practicality, simplicity, and emphasis on personalized remedies. Its philosophy is based on the principles of karma, past debts, and planetary influences, and it aims to provide practical solutions to individuals seeking guidance.
